Balkan SA:MP

PAWN skriptanje, gamemodovi, filterskripte, include fajlovi, mape, pluginovi => Razgovor u vezi PAWN - skriptanja => Temu započeo: [IF] mariomako poslato Maj 06, 2011, 22:59:03 POSLE PODNE

Naslov: [pomoc] zasto imam ove errore
Poruka od: [IF] mariomako poslato Maj 06, 2011, 22:59:03 POSLE PODNE
skriptu koju koristim: gamemode od 0
detaljan opis problema: zasto dobijam ove errore

C:\Documents and Settings\Mome\Desktop\Infinity DM Stunt\gamemodes\infinitygm.pwn(307) : error 029: invalid expression, assumed zero
C:\Documents and Settings\Mome\Desktop\Infinity DM Stunt\gamemodes\infinitygm.pwn(307) : warning 217: loose indentation
C:\Documents and Settings\Mome\Desktop\Infinity DM Stunt\gamemodes\infinitygm.pwn(307) : error 029: invalid expression, assumed zero
C:\Documents and Settings\Mome\Desktop\Infinity DM Stunt\gamemodes\infinitygm.pwn(307) : error 029: invalid expression, assumed zero
C:\Documents and Settings\Mome\Desktop\Infinity DM Stunt\gamemodes\infinitygm.pwn(307) : fatal error 107: too many error messages on one line


dio skripte:

public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if(dialogid==DIALOG_LANG)
    {
     switch(listitem)
       {
         case 0:
         {
             SetPVarInt(playerid,"language",1);
         }
         case 1:
         {
             SetPVarInt(playerid,"language",2);
        }
       }
}
return 1;
}
Naslov: Odg: [pomoc] zasto imam ove errore
Poruka od: System32 poslato Maj 06, 2011, 23:02:06 POSLE PODNE
kojo je linija 307? usput probaj ovako staviti
if(dialogid==DIALOG_LANG)
Naslov: Odg: [pomoc] zasto imam ove errore
Poruka od: [IF] mariomako poslato Maj 06, 2011, 23:03:47 POSLE PODNE
Citat: System32 poslato Maj 06, 2011, 23:02:06 POSLE PODNE
kojo je linija 307? usput probaj ovako staviti
if(dialogid==DIALOG_LANG)

if(dialogid==DIALOG_LANG) 
      {  // linija 307


probao sam ali nece
Naslov: Odg: [pomoc] zasto imam ove errore
Poruka od: [A]Dexter poslato Maj 06, 2011, 23:04:28 POSLE PODNE
ja nisam pro i mozda neznam ali ja msm da treba ovako

public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
  if(dialogid==DIALOG_LANG)
     {
      switch(listitem)
        {
          case 0:
          {
              SetPVarInt(playerid,"language",1);
          }
          case 1:
          {
              SetPVarInt(playerid,"language",2);
          }
      }
  }
  return 1;
}


edit 1 : jer ti zagrade nisu fino postavljene ja msm da je tako nisam siguran ako nije nezamjeri
Naslov: Odg: [pomoc] zasto imam ove errore
Poruka od: caupton poslato Maj 06, 2011, 23:04:50 POSLE PODNE
if(dialog==DIALOG_LANG)

Ovako bi trebalo
Naslov: Odg: [pomoc] zasto imam ove errore
Poruka od: BloodMaster poslato Maj 06, 2011, 23:07:08 POSLE PODNE
Citat: *BS*Nikola.pwn poslato Maj 06, 2011, 23:04:50 POSLE PODNE
stavi ovako i ima da ti radi if(dialogid==DIALOG_LANG) ;

Zasto zatvaranje procesa iako nista nije napravljeno? To bi onda bila provjera koja nicemu nesluzi...


@Tema

Daj definiciju DIALOG_LANG i samo poravnaj sa TAB tipkom
Naslov: Odg: [pomoc] zasto imam ove errore
Poruka od: [IF] mariomako poslato Maj 06, 2011, 23:18:00 POSLE PODNE
Citat: Dexter poslato Maj 06, 2011, 23:04:28 POSLE PODNE
ja nisam pro i mozda neznam ali ja msm da treba ovako

public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
  if(dialogid==DIALOG_LANG)
     {
      switch(listitem)
        {
          case 0:
          {
              SetPVarInt(playerid,"language",1);
          }
          case 1:
          {
              SetPVarInt(playerid,"language",2);
          }
      }
  }
  return 1;
}


edit 1 : jer ti zagrade nisu fino postavljene ja msm da je tako nisam siguran ako nije nezamjeri

ma pro si :D

hvala ovo radi